Job Description

Legal Operations is seeking a talented Program Management Associate (non-technical) to join the team to assist with department programs and initiatives. The successful candidate must have strong attention to detail, the ability to handle multiple projects, and excellent interpersonal and communication skills.  This position will report to the Senior Program Manager of Training & Legal Programs.

  • As a program management associate, you will support the planning and execution of various projects and initiatives across the Legal, Ethics & Compliance function.

  • You will work closely with the program manager, team leaders, and stakeholders to ensure that the goals, objectives, and deliverables are met.

  • You will also assist with reporting, communication, and documentation of the program activities and outcomes.

Essential Functions

  • Coordinate, schedule and support multiple department meetings, orientations, initiative events and trainings programs, ensuring that they are aligned with the strategic priorities and operational plans of the organization.

  • Provide administrative and logistical support for all department town hall meetings, trainings, and events to ensure meeting rooms are reserved and other logistics are timely made, including making sure internal partners are also aligned with necessary logistical support.

  • Timely prepare and disseminate calendar invites, department communications (including newsletters, new hires and department initiatives/events announcements), meeting/program presentation slide decks, and other relevant materials, while ensuring proper communication processes are followed.

  • Communicate effectively with internal and external stakeholders, such as program presenters, partners, and participants to ensure all necessary content and information are obtained, and the program expectations and requirements are met.

  • Assist with maintaining and updating department SharePoint site/intranet and resources to ensure contents and materials are current.

  • Assist with issuance of Mandatory Continuing Legal Education (MCLE) credit to relevant training participants and maintenance of records to ensure continuous compliance as an MCLE provider with the State Bar of California, and provisioning user access to CLE provider, Practicing Law Institute and other online resources.

  • Collaborate with University team partners to create/add learning content on online learning platform, and to assign University credit for participating in learning events.

  • Provide support for department special projects as appropriate.

  • Analyze and evaluate the delivery and impact of program initiatives and/or events, using qualitative and quantitative data, and provide feedback and recommendations for improvement.

  • Identify and escalate any issues or risks that may affect the program delivery and quality, and propose solutions to mitigate them.

  • Contribute to the continuous improvement of the processes and practices used to deliver program initiatives/events, and share best practices and lessons learned with program manager and stakeholders.
